The latest research from Incisive Buzz asks, do Isas still offer value to investors? Those who stated 'yes' made these additional comments: • If fulfilling every year's maxima, definitely. • Tax-free income, no capital gains tax (CGT) and does not have to go on tax return all at no extra cost. • With this Government you should take anything that has tax-free on it before they take it away. • Cash definitely, others marginal. • Yes, for higher rate taxpayers wanting income. • No significant value apart from tax concessions where applicable. • Yes, but more to hold corporate bo...
